Linkstation LS220D refuses all connections

Hello,
my new LS220D stops responding to my PC after a few minutes.

I can hear a "click" noise out of the NAS like when it powers down and i get these Errors:

Chrome: "192.168.178.99 refused connection" ERR_CONNECTION_REFUSED
Filezilla (FTP): ECONNREFUSED - Connection refused by Server

When the Error happens, at first i get a white browser Page from the NAS and after a refresh, chrome gives me the Error message again.

When i restart the NAS everything works as intended. I can make a full Backup of my Documents etc. but then after a few minutes of inactivity this happens again.

The NAS tells me that it already has the newest Firmware so i can't update it to resolve this error.
Can anyone tell me whats happening here?
